Company Description

American Iron & Metal (AIM) is a family-owned company and recognized global leader in the metal recycling industry with more than 125 sites and 4000 employees worldwide. We have continued to prosper for the last eight decades thanks to the dedication of our employees and the ongoing trust and support of our customers.

Become part of team AIM, a growing team with an entrepreneurial spirit who has over the years evolved into a successful and multifaceted company with business divisions that include metal recycling, decommissioning and demolition, auto-parts sales and recycling, manufacturing of solder assemblies, construction waste recycling, and production of customized industrial and mining products.

We take pride in doing good things for the environment to help create a greener, more sustainable future for all.

Job Description

We are currently recruiting for a General Labourer with experience for our Sault Ste Marie location. Under the supervision of the Site Manager, the incumbent will be responsible for the general maintenance of the premises. 

  • Receive, sort and organize different types of ferrous metals
  • Cover the scale and weigh in trucks when required using the RECY system to properly weigh and track the material
  • Do general maintenance of the premises
  • Ensure the equipment in good condition
  • Provide excellent customer service to clients on site
  • Operate the Fork lift as required
  • Work with a safety oriented mindset

Qualifications

  • Good computer skills 
  • Experience in operating a crane
  • Experience in metal recycling considered an asset
  • Ability to work indoors/outdoors in all weather conditions
  • Good physical fitness
  • Ability to work as a team
